Vitamin K does the opposite of thinning. It accelerates the clotting.
The Delta variant has led to a severe concern about horrible blood clotting for the young. Clots can start from the legs and move towards the heart.
An article just published in the BMJ shows that the infection induced clotting is way in excess - about 10 times that's due to the clotting effect noticed for vaccines.
It's suspected that damage to the endothelial cells, causes a triggering the body’s clotting mechanism. Under this scenario the doctors will advise to take a blood thinner for a while, for those infected & recovered with Covid.
The only thinner you can take is Cartia.. which is a low dose aspirin that could help. Do not try others without medical advice.
